Palo Alto Networks, Inc. (NASDAQ: PANW) is a global leader in cybersecurity, headquartered in Santa Clara, California, and founded in 2005. The company offers a comprehensive platform of advanced security solutions spanning network security, cloud security, and security operations, anchored by its next-generation firewalls and complemented by its Prisma (cloud and SASE) and Cortex (endpoint protection and XDR) product families. Under the leadership of Chairman and CEO Nikesh Arora, Palo Alto Networks serves over 70,000 organizations across more than 150 countries — including 85 of the Fortune 100 — spanning industries such as financial services, healthcare, government, and telecommunications. With a market capitalization exceeding $220 billion, the company distributes its hardware appliances, virtualized software, and subscription-based cloud services through both direct sales and an extensive network of channel partners.
